IN THE H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T MADRAS

( Criminal Jurisdiction ) Wednesday, the Twenty Third day of March Two Thousand Twenty Two PRESENT The Hon`ble Dr Justice G. JAYACHANDRAN CRIMINAL ORIGINAL PETITION No.6679 of 2022 JAYALAKSHMI [ PETITIONER / ACCUSED ] Vs THE STATE REP.BY ITS [ RESPONDENT ] THE INSPECTOR OF POLICE (CRIME), R-10 POLICE STATION, M.G.R.NAGAR, CHENNAI-600 078.

(CR.NO.NOT KNOWN OF 2022) For Petitioner : M/S.E.SIVANANDAN Advocate For Respondent : MR.S.SANTHOSH, Govt. Advocate ( Crl. Side) PETITION FOR ANTICIPATORY BAIL Under Sec. 438 Cr.P.C. ORDER : The Court Made the following order :- When the matter is taken up for consideration, the learned Government Advocate (Crl. Side) submitted that the complaint given by the defacto complainant was assigned C.S.R.No.164 of 2019 and petition enquiry is pending. If the petitioner cooperate for the enquiry, the same will be completed within three weeks and till then they will not arrest the petitioner.

2.In view of the above submission made by the learned Government Advocate (Crl. Side), this Court directs the respondent to complete the enquiry, within a period of three we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order and not to arrest the petitioner till then provided he co-operate for enquiry.

3.This petition is accordingly disposed of.
